What’s Happening in Freight and Logistics Industry?

Australian freight and logistics industry is firmly in the pilot phase. Companies are deploying electric trucks for specific, suitable tasks like last-mile deliveries in metropolitan areas and fixed short-to-medium haul routes.

These electric trials are crucial. They’re helping manufacturers understand battery performance in our unique conditions and are giving fleets real data on running costs, maintenance, and charging cycles.

The Challenge: Roadblocks on the Australian Highway

Let’s be frank, this transition isn’t without its potholes. The two biggest hurdles are cost and infrastructure.

The upfront price of an electric truck is significant, and the national network of heavy vehicle charging stations is still in its infancy, creating serious “range anxiety” for interstate hauls.

Furthermore, Australia’s patchwork of state-based regulations presents a unique headache. The weight regulations change at each state border.

High Vehicle Cost and Infrastructure in Australian Trucking Industry
The real challenge for operators and drivers is high vehicle repairing cost and infrastructure in the process of EV transition.

Electric trucks, with their heavy battery packs, often weigh more than their diesel counterparts. This can lead to complex compliance issues, forcing operators to choose between carrying less cargo or facing potential penalties when crossing borders, a logistical nightmare that eats into profitability.
